Organization of the Hilbert space for exact diagonalization of Hubbard model

From MaRDI portal
Publication:314006

DOI10.1016/J.CPC.2015.03.014zbMATH Open1344.82029arXiv1307.7542OpenAlexW2079873678MaRDI QIDQ314006FDOQ314006


Authors: Medha Sharma, M. A. H. Ahsan Edit this on Wikidata


Publication date: 12 September 2016

Published in: Computer Physics Communications (Search for Journal in Brave)

Abstract: We present an alternative scheme to the widely used method of representing the basis of one-band Hubbard model through the relation I=Iuparrow+2MIdownarrow given by H. Q. Lin and J. E. Gubernatis [Comput. Phys. 7, 400 (1993)], where Iuparrow, Idownarrow and I are the integer equivalents of binary representations of occupation patterns of spin up, spin down and both spin up and spin down electrons respectively, with M being the number of sites. We compute and store only Iuparrow or Idownarrow at a time to generate the full Hamiltonian matrix. The non-diagonal part of the Hamiltonian matrix given as is generated using a bottom-up approach by computing the small matrices (spin up hopping Hamiltonian) and (spin down hopping Hamiltonian) and then forming the tensor product with respective identity matrices calIdownarrow and calIuparrow, thereby saving significant computation time and memory. We find that the total CPU time to generate the non-diagonal part of the Hamiltonian matrix using the new one spin configuration basis scheme is reduced by about an order of magnitude as compared to the two spin configuration basis scheme. The present scheme is shown to be inherently parallelizable. Its application to translationally invariant systems, computation of Green's functions and in impurity solver part of DMFT procedure is discussed and its extention to other models is also pointed out.


Full work available at URL: https://arxiv.org/abs/1307.7542




Recommendations




Cites Work


Cited In (4)





This page was built for publication: Organization of the Hilbert space for exact diagonalization of Hubbard model

Report a bug (only for logged in users!)Click here to report a bug for this page (MaRDI item Q314006)